How do I create a “My work this week” selection in Maintmaster?
This article explains how to create a selection that shows work orders assigned to the current user for the current week in Maintmaster. It is intended for users who want a quick overview of their weekly workload.

Start from the built-in work order selection
Steps
-
Go to All selections.
-
Open the Work orders section.
-
Select the built-in work order selection
(This is the one without a “Created by” value.)

Apply filters
Steps
-
Click Filter.
-
Add filter: Responsible = Current user.

-
Add filter: Start date = Start of this week → End of this week.

This ensures the selection shows only work orders:
-
Assigned to the logged-in user.
-
Scheduled within the current week.
Customize columns
Adjust the visible columns to fit your needs.
Recommended changes
-
Remove:
-
Created by
-
Created
-
Last changed by
-
-
Add:
-
Start date
-
Deadline
-
You can drag and reorder columns as needed.

If no records appear, it may simply mean the current user has no assigned work orders for this week.
Save the selection
Steps
-
Click Options.
-
Select Save as new selection.

-
Enter:
-
Name: My work this week
-
Description: Shows all work orders with a start date this week for the current user
-
-
Enable Add to menu.
-
(Optional) Choose an icon and color.
-
Set visibility (e.g., available for all users).
-
Click Save.

Result
The new selection will:
-
Appear in the menu.
-
Automatically adapt to the current user.
-
Show each user their own work orders for the week.

Troubleshooting
No work orders are shown
-
The user may not have any work orders assigned this week.
-
Check filter settings (especially Responsible and Start date).
Selection is not visible in the menu
-
Ensure Add to menu was selected during setup.
-
Verify user permissions.
